President praises brave youth

President Nguyen Minh Triet March 25 sent a letter praising Nguyen Van Tien for his bravery in saving his friend.

Nguyen Van Tien and his mother at the National Institute for Burns in Hanoi (Photo: Tien Phong)

Tien, 17, from the northern province of Phu Tho, saved his friend from being electrocuted to death from a high voltage post while they were fitting aluminum frames for glass panels in Ha Noi January 17.

He was seriously burned and doctors had to amputate his arms and left leg.

‘I am much moved by your brave action but also so heart broken because you lost your arms and leg when you are so young. Your action comes from good, lofty and strong awareness. You are deserving of the title of heroic Vietnamese youth,’ President Triet wrote.

‘I wish you will soon recover and be strong to overcome the injury to have a good future. I am very glad to know that central organizations and other individuals and organizations in the country had contributed assistance after your noble action.'

‘Sending you a lot of my kisses,’ the president ended his letter.
